Man accused of Starlight Drive-In shooting in custody

The AJC just reported that Quentric S. Williams, the man accused of shooting and killing Mitt Lenix at Starlight Drive-In early Tuesday morning, was taken into custody in Gwinnett County this afternoon.

Quentric S. Williams, 32, was taken into custody in a hotel at the corner of Steve Reynolds Boulevard and Club Drive, according to police. Williams, of Lilburn, is accused of shooting 28-year-old Mitt Lenix, a martial arts expert and entertainer, late Monday night.

According to a DeKalb County incident report, the woman who was at the movies with Lenix told officers their car wouldn't start, so Lenix approached a nearby vehicle for help. She said she heard "two pops" and Lenix scream, and saw him lying facedown on the ground moments later. A witness and EMT attempted to assist Lenix before emergency crews arrived. Lenix was taken to Grady where he died from his injuries.
